Pros

I have been with Cielo for over three years since it was Ochre House and it has been a great company to work for! I have experienced strong and supportive management with all leaders highly approachable. There has been a real opportunity for training and development, with good career progression (having been promoted twice in three years). Internal mobility is good and the people and culture really make it enjoyable coming to work every day!

Cons

The company went through a merger which has meant organisational change and a lot to get your head around at times, however management have kept the communication going as reassurance through team meetings and our all hands monthly calls which has been reassuring!

Pros

--The team is amazing. My manager is super flexible and genuinely cares about her team. My coworkers are super friendly. There is ALWAYS someone there to help you out. --The dress code! Very open. We get to wear jeans on a regular basis, and it's casual-wear on Fridays. --Food! There is always free food, though you have to hurry if you want to beat the rush. --Professionalism. This job manages to pull off being incredibly professional as well as a fun environment. I love the culture. --Compensation. The pay is fair for what you do. I can't speak on the benefits. --Again, the environment. I love going to work. It's not a drag. If you need a boost of energy, there is plenty to go around. So many people ask me how my weekend was, I love it. --Flexible hours. I only work a part of the week, which is absolutely incredible. It gives me time to take care of classwork and my passions in life. If I need to take a day off for an emergency or something, my manager is always so understanding. I got ill a few months ago and my manager was very supportive. I thought I would get fired but when I returned to work, she asked me how I was doing and watched me hop right back on the saddle.

Cons

--Socializing. Sometimes my team members can get a little too chatty and the productivity for the day goes down. They encourage each other to work hard, but they do talk a lot at times. --Late Notice for Temporary Lay-offs. I am LTE, meaning limited term employment. I expected that my hours can be cut at any time. I'm not full-time. However, I did not appreciate the late notice on these cuts or being temporarily laid-off the day-of. I go into work and they say "Oh, you won't be working (for this amount of time)." However, I do know that my job is secure, but a little more of a head's up would have been nice.
